A gap theorem for $\alpha$-harmonic maps between two-spheres

Abstract

In this paper we consider approximations introduced by Sacks-Uhlenbeck of the harmonic energy for maps from S2S^2 into S2S^2. We continue the analysis in [6] about limits of α\alpha-harmonic maps with uniformly bounded energy. Using a recent energy identity in [7], we obtain an optimal gap theorem for the α\alpha-harmonic maps of degree 1,0-1, 0 or 11.
